Chronic Skin Ulcers: Accelerating Healing with PRP Therapy and Homeopathy
Chronic skin ulcers are open sores that, due to the presence of a disease, do not heal within a typical time period. These ulcers usually result from diabetes, venous insufficiency, or prolonged pressure. Severe complications can be encountered through infections and reduced quality of life.
How PRP Therapy Helps Heal
PRP is harvested from the patient’s blood with higher concentrations of platelets and growth factors. For chronic ulcers, when used, PRP will provide the following functions:
Improve Tissue Repair: Growth factors found in PRP stimulate cellular multiplication and promote tissue repair with quicker recovery from chronic ulcers.
Diminish Inflammation: PRP has anti-inflammatory effects; thus, the inflammation associated with chronic ulcers, and pain, could be lessened.
It increases the formation of neovasculature, helping the tissue to receive proper oxygen and nutrient supply due to this newly formed blood.
PRP Treatment Protocol for Chronic Ulcers
Consultation: A medical practitioner evaluates the ulcer and decides whether the patient is suitable for PRP treatment.
Blood Collection: A small amount of blood from the patient is collected.
Preparation of PRP: Concentration of platelets and growth factors is achieved through the processing of blood.
Application: In most cases, the concentrated PRP is applied right to the ulcer with typical wound care treatments.
Follow-Up: A course may require more than one procedure depending on how well an ulcer heals after the treatment.
PRP Therapy Benefits
Autogenous Treatment: As PRP involves the use of blood products from a patient’s own person, allergic reactions or chance of transferring infection are limited.
Minimally Invasive: PRP treatment is a relatively simple procedure and can be done as an outpatient.
Complementary Treatment: PRP can be administered along with other treatments for greater healing benefits.
Considerations and Future Directions
Though PRP therapy seems to hold promise, it’s effectiveness depends on ulcer etiology and patient’s status of health. Further studies will further seek optimization of PRP preparation and application methods to maximize the benefits in healing.
